Rocco and His Brothers
(1960)Five brothers move north with their mother to Milan, finding fame in the boxing ring and love in the same woman. Labeled by Scorsese as βone of the most sumptuous black-and-white pictures,β this is a timeless story of modernity, class tension, and family drama by director Luchino Visconti and staring Alain Delon.
